A CAGR calculator (Compound Annual Growth Rate calculator) is used to determine the consistent annual return your investment has delivered (or needs to deliver) over a specific period.
Unlike absolute return, which shows total gain or loss, CAGR shows how much your investment would have grown if it had compounded at a steady rate each year. It smooths out the volatility and provides a standardised rate for comparison.

The CAGR calculator uses the following standard formula to determine the compound annual growth rate:
CAGR = ((Ending Value / Beginning Value) ^ (1 / Number of Years) – 1) * 100

SIP CAGR Calculator :
The SIP CAGR calculator helps investors understand the annual growth rate of their Systematic Investment Plan (SIP) contributions. Most SIP CAGR calculators use the XIRR (Extended Internal Rate of Return) method to account for multiple cash flows, offering more accurate returns than the basic CAGR formula. It's ideal for salaried individuals who are investing in mutual funds.

Reverse CAGR Calculator :
A reverse CAGR calculator is an online tool that helps you estimate the future value of an investment using a known compound annual growth rate (CAGR). Unlike traditional CAGR calculators that determine growth based on known starting and ending values, the reverse version allows you to project how much your current investment could grow, making it a valuable resource for goal-based financial planning.
